About this Plant

Hidcote Giant Lavender (Lavandula x intermedia 'Hidcote Giant') is a magnificent, large-growing hybrid lavender — a cross between English lavender and spike lavender — producing exceptionally long, deep purple flower spikes on tall, upright stems that tower impressively above a broad, billowing mound of aromatic silver-green foliage. Named after the celebrated Hidcote Manor Garden in the English Cotswolds, this stately cultivar delivers some of the longest and most dramatic flower spikes of any lavender available, combined with an intensely rich fragrance and outstanding heat and drought tolerance that makes it exceptional for bold landscape statements, large container plantings, and premier cut flower and dried lavender production.

These 4" healthy live plants thrive in full sun (6–8 hours daily) with excellent drainage — plant in well-drained to sandy or gravelly soil and water moderately until established, after which minimal supplemental irrigation is needed. Hardy in USDA zones 5–9, growing 24–36" tall with a spread of 24–36". Deep purple flower spikes bloom in midsummer (July–August); shear by one-third immediately after peak bloom to maintain a tidy, compact form and extend the productive life of the plant for many seasons.
